Idaho Theatre

Uploaded By

Tiny dallasmovietheaters

Featured Theater

Idaho Theatre, Twin Falls

Idaho Theatre

Twin Falls, ID

More Photos

Photo Info

Uploaded on: June 24, 2019

Size: 1.6 MB

Views: 777

License:

Idaho Theatre

The Idaho Theatre in Twin Falls closed with “This is My Alaska” on January 20, 1970. It was demolished in February of 1970.

Unfavorite No one has favorited this photo yet

You must login before making a comment.

New Comment